my 1944 BSA M20

This one came to me in 1988 pretty much as you see it. It was still in postwar Bronze Green paint,with the auction numbers still on it-the bike had been in storage for a number of years with about 5 other M20s in Canada. Original pannier bags and a full toolset came with the bike. I took it back to its wartime configuration, by taking off the postwar number plates. The '104' Royal Artillery formation sign was under a layer of paint,long with other markings, such as "Drive on the right" painted in big red letters on the top of the tank (I have the keycard-this machine was rebuilt in Germany in 1953 by REME)
